On Wed, Mar 19, 2014 at 2:27 PM, Paul Galati <[email protected]> wrote:
> Should I be seeing my own messages come back to me?  I see that you have
> read and replied, but I never got my original back.
>

Normally yes, but with gmail accounts using the web front end, no.
Gmail automatically ignores the message from the list that gets sent
back to your address, for all mailing lists where it understands that
it's a list (and they know mailman, the mailing list software we use).
With IMAP or POP3 clients on Gmail you will see your own posts come
through as a separate message in most mail clients. With Gmail
otherwise, you have to check the list archive to verify it was sent.

That isn't something that's changed recently. Gmail started doing that
in roughly 2006-2007 IIRC (I've been using it since 2004). Prior to
that change, you would have that list thread pop up into your inbox as
unread when your own message went through. That's not something that's
controlled by the mailing list, and I don't think it's something you
can configure on the Gmail side.
